This is due to a previous Arm Failure alarm which has not been cleared.
An Arm Failure alarm is triggered when the system fails to arm due to
exit delay time out or a zone open after the entry door is closed. When
this happens, the system must be disarmed before it can be armed
again. Any attempt to arm when there is an alarm active will result in he
message "Call Engineer to Reset".

No Voice on Keypad when Arming or Disarming

For Firmware Versions 4.6X and older, announcements like "Please Exit",
"Away Mode", "Security Off" are heard on the keypad when arming or
disarming. If the local phone is taken offhook when arming or disarming,
the voice will not be heard on the keypad. This is to allow the phone to
arm or disarm. This may also be caused by a faulty telephone.

Sign-in Codes Lost

User Code Lost

Go To Program Menu (Engineer menu 9), 5 for User Codes and 0 to
Erase all Users or 2 to Erase a single user by number. If all users are
deleted, the default user code is reset to 1234, and all messages in
mailboxes will be erased.
Individual users can be deleted in Program Menu 5,2 and selecting the
user number. All the messages in that mailbox will be deleted. The user
must be added using Program Menu 5,1 (Add User).

Engineer Code Lost

Engineer Code cannot be recovered using the keypad. Comfigurator can
be used to transfer the program from System -> PC and the Engineer
code can be seen from the Security -> Sign in Codes screen. This
method can also be used to recover lost user codes so that messages do
not have to be erased.
